The vote was 5-0,unanimous in favor. 51 52 NEW PUBLIC HEARINGS 53 318_Salem Street,Jaime Lyn-Pickles:Application for a Watershed Special Permit under Article 4 Part 5 and Article t0 54 Section 195-10.7 of the Zoning Bylaw to authorize construction of an inground pool and concrete apron within the 325'Non- 55 Discharge Zone of the Watershed Protection District. The property is located in the Residential 3 zoning district. 56 J.Enriuht: The lot was created in 1980;on town water and sewer.The proposed pool location is within the 325'Non- 57 Discharge buffer to a wetland resource area;approximately 161 feet from the edge of a bordering vegetated wetland. The 58 project involves construction of a 15' x 32' inground pool with a 4-foot concrete apron, located in the rear of the existing 59 house. Stormwater management for the site is proposed by the conveyance of all runoff from the pool area into a 2' wide 60 stone infiltration trench,at a depth of 2',During construction,the perimeter of work will be protected with staked erosion 61 control barrier to prevent migration of sediment from the site until final stabilization. Stormwater peer review was conducted 62 by Horsley Witten;all concerns have been addressed. Specifically,the erosion control barrier has been extended,a 63 construction entrance and stockpile area were added to the plan; a maintenance log has been added to the Operations and 64 Maintenance Plan, 65 Jaime-Lyn Pickles,homeowner &David Beati: Provided brief history of the home built in 1957 by her great uncle;third 66 generation to own the home. Tied into town sewer in 2023. Lots were recreated based on an ANR lot change when 314 and 67 318 were split.The lot was altered again in 2008 to allow for construction of a garage. 68 David Beati,PPS Land Surveying,Inc:Confirmed no water builduplponding on the property and that the pool mechanicals 69 are proposed to be located to the reap of the house where the patio is located.The location of the brook sits 10-12' below 70 grade of proposed pool. It would take a tremendous storm to allow water to rise over the banks up the slope.No evidence of 71 water while surveying the property. Stormwater management has been overdesigned. 72 E.Goldberg: Stressed importance of deed restriction relating to use of fertilizers in the watershed proximate to the lake. 73 MOTION: S. Simons seconded 76 the motion.The vote was 5-0,unanimous in favor. 77 78 DISCUSSION ITEMS: 79 314 Salem Street,David Pickles: Request for Waiver of a Watershed Special Permit to allow for the construction of a 6' xx 80 30' farmer's porch primarily within the Non-Discharge Zone;however,a small portion is located within the Non-Disturbance 81 .Zone. 82 J. Enright: This lot was also created in 1980; lot served by town water and sewer. Land disturbance consists of the installation 83 of 5 concrete footings.There is a wetland resource area at the west corner of the parcel,northwest of the proposed work.The 84 Conservation Administrator has confirmed the accuracy of the wetland flagging and the work requires a Small Project 85 application with the Conservation Commission. Proposed disturbance is located approximately 91' from the edge of the 86 bordering vegetated wetland.Stormmwater management consists of the conveyance of all runoff fi-om the proposed rooftop into 87 a 2-foot diameter leaching catch basin,as a depth of 2-feet.The basin will be encased in a 12-inch width of clean,crushed 88 stone,wrapped in filter fabric.During construction,the perimeter of work will be protected with a staked erosion control 89 barrier. J.Borgesi,Town Engineer,peer reviewed the stormwater management design finding it acceptable. 90 MOTION: S.Kevlahan made a motion to approve the Waiver of Watershed Special Permit for 314 Salem Street.J.
